Land Development for Housing and Industry

Virginia Cooperative Extension publication 460-115 reviews geotechnical and engineering principles that govern settlement of filled lands, such as reclaimed mines, and the distortion of building structures built on such lands. Surface mine settlement is rapid, relative to the tolerances of most building structures, especially in the years immediately following mining and reclamation.

Virginia Cooperative Extension publication 460-130 describes procedures that can be used to stabilize land surfaces created by mining so as to improve suitability for development. The most cost-effective surface stabilization measures take place during placement of spoils that will produce the final land surface. Good mine planning can have a positive impact on the cost of such measures.

In 1998, Powell River Project worked with Virginia Department of Mines, Minerals and Energy, and Virginia Coalfield Economic Development Authority, to assist these agencies' development of procedures to allow and encourage development of appropriately configured and located mine sites as industrial sites. Virginia Cooperative Extension publication 460-132 describes planning, permitting, and reclamation procedures that can aide the process of preparing mined areas for use as industrial sites after mining. Both regulatory issues and land development procedures are addressed.
